Php 我想要一个易于理解的代码,根据今天的日期从表中选择一组行

Php 我想要一个易于理解的代码,根据今天的日期从表中选择一组行,php,laravel,Php,Laravel,我是初学者,我试图根据今天的日期显示员工出勤情况列表。我需要一个以上条件的代码示例,我尝试了很多方法,但没有一个是我用的,我将提供表结构。请指导我一步一步的程序,我真的是一个有耐心的人 Table: empatten ================ empid empname empstatus (whether present or absent) doa (date of attendance) This is my show blade ===================== @

我是初学者,我试图根据今天的日期显示员工出勤情况列表。我需要一个以上条件的代码示例,我尝试了很多方法,但没有一个是我用的,我将提供表结构。请指导我一步一步的程序,我真的是一个有耐心的人

Table: empatten
================

empid
empname
empstatus (whether present or absent)
doa (date of attendance)

This is my show blade
=====================
@extends ('empatten.layout')
<html>
<head>
<title>Display attendance information</title>
</head>
<body>
<div class="row">
        <div class="col-lg-12 margin-tb">
                        <div class="pull-right">
                <a class="btn btn-success" href="{{ route

('empatten.index') }}">Back</a>
            </div>
        </div>
    </div>
<table class="tableizer-table">
<thead>

<tr class="tableizer-firstrow">
<th>Emp ID</th>
<th>Emp Name</th>
<th>Emp Status</th>
<th>Action</th>
</tr></thead><tbody>
@foreach($empatten as $attens)

 <tr>
     <td>{{ $attens->empid }}</td>
 <td>{{ $attens->empname }}</td>
 <td>{{ $attens->empstatus }}</td>
 <td>{{ $attens->doa }}</td>

</tr>
@endforeach
</tbody></table>
</body>
</html>

This is my Index Page:
=========================

@extends('empatten.layout')
@section('content')

    <div class="row">
        <div class="col-lg-12 margin-tb">
            <div class="pull-left">
                <h2>Employee Management Page</h2>
            </div>
            <br><br>
            <div class="pull-left">
                <a class="btn btn-success" href="{{ route('empatten.create') }}"> Add Todays Attendance</a>
            </div>
            <br><br>
            <div class="pull-left">
                <a class="btn btn-success" href="{{ route('empatten.show') }}"> View Todays Attendance</a>
            </div>
        </div>
    </div>

This is my controller show function
+++++++++++++++++++++++++++++++++++++

 public function show(Empatten $empatten)
    {
        return view('empatten.show',compact('empatten'));
       //->with('empatten', empatten::all());    

    }
表:empaten
================
舞虻
empname
EMP状态(无论是否存在)
doa(出席日期)
这是我的展示刀
=====================
@扩展('empaten.layout')
显示出勤信息
Emp ID
Emp名称
Emp状态
行动
@foreach($empaten作为$attens)
{{$attens->empid}
{{$attens->empname}
{{$attens->empstatus}
{{$attens->doa}
@endforeach
这是我的索引页:
=========================
@扩展('empaten.layout')
@节(“内容”)
员工管理页面




这是我的控制器显示功能 +++++++++++++++++++++++++++++++++++++ 公共功能展示(Empaten$Empaten) { 返回视图('empaten.show',紧凑型('empaten'); //->使用('empaten',empaten::all()); }
试试这个, $employee_attention=YourModelName::whereDate('doe',Carbon::today())->get();
这里的YourModelName是Empaten表的您的模型

这是一个简单的方法,可以根据您的需要使用。。此处
\Carbon\Carbon::now()
获取今天的日期

public function show()
    {
        $empatten = Empatten::where('created_at', Carbon::today())->get();
        return view('empatten.show',compact('empatten')); 

    }

“请指导我一步一步的程序”-请阅读。我们不是来给你完整的教程的。您需要学习自己正在使用的技术的基础知识。我们可以在具体问题上帮助您,但这太宽泛和开放了。这不是一个代码编写服务。对不起,我是一个初学者,出于兴趣,我设计了这么大的一个。。。不管怎样,谢谢你的建议你面临的具体问题是什么?您是否得到错误(请具体说明),您是否得到任何结果,您是否得到错误结果(为什么它们“错误”)?感谢您宝贵的方法。我正在index.blade中使用以下代码,当我单击“查看今天的考勤”时,我收到404未找到错误。代码是:404表示没有定义路由